湖南省4株猪繁殖与呼吸综合征病毒全基因组序列测定与分析

摘    要:为了解湖南省猪繁殖与呼吸综合征病毒(PRRSV)的遗传变异情况,对湖南省2016-2019年分离的4株PRRSV(Hunan/2016/075、Hunan/2017/085、Hunan/2018/123、Hunan/2019/055)进行全基因组测序,对其ORF5、NSP2基因以及全基因组核苷酸序列进行分析。结果显示,分离的4株病毒株均为美洲型,全基因组同源性为83.1%~98.7%,其中3株属于高致病型,1株为属于类NADC30型。Hunan/2016/075、Hunan/2017/085毒株全长序列与谱系5中亚系5.1的代表性毒株BJ-4亲缘关系相近,聚为一簇;Hunan/2018/123毒株与谱系8.7中的tjnh1501毒株聚为一簇;Hunan/2019/055毒株独立成一簇,与谱系1亲缘关系相近。本研究掌握了湖南省PRRSV的遗传变异情况,从而为制定有效的防控策略提供了依据。

Determination and Analysis on the Complete Genomic Sequence of Four Strains of PRRS Virus in Hunan Province

Abstract:In order to recognize the genetic variation of porcine reproductive and respiratory syndrome virus(PRRSV)in Hunan Province,4 strains of PRRSV(Hunan/2016/075,Hunan/2017/085,Hunan/2018/123 and Hunan/2019/055)isolated from 2016 to 2019 in the province were sequenced,and their ORF5 and NSP2 genes and nucleotide sequences of their complete gene were analyzed.The results showed that all the four strains belonged into North American(NA)type,with the homology of complete genome of 83.1%to 98.7%,in which,3 strains were highly pathogenic and 1 strain was classified as NADC30-like strain.In view of the genetic relationship,the fulllength sequences of Hunan/2016/075 and Hunan/2017/085 were similar to BJ-4 strain,the representative one of 5.1 substrain of 5 family,which were clustered into one cluster;Hunan/2018/123 was clustered together with tjnh1501 strain of 8.7 family;and Hunan/2019/055 formed one cluster by itself,which was similar to 1 family concerning its genetic relationship.In short,the status of genetic variation of PRRSV in Hunan Province was identified,which would provide some references for developing effective control measures.
